Baryon number violated proton decays (or nucleon decays in general) have been extensively looked for in the super-Kamiokande-I detector. Thanks to its huge detector size and excellent particle identification capability, we obtained the most stringent lower limit on nucleon partial lifetime for various decay modes. From the full super-Kamiokande-I data (1489 days livetime or 91.6 kton·year exposure), the obtained experimental limit is 5.4 × 1033 years for p→ e+ π 0 mode and 2.2 × 1033 years for p→ ν K + mode at 90% confidence level. ¯
